CHARLTON (née Farrell) (Maureen) (Blackrock, Co. Dublin) - August 10, 2007 (peacefully) at Blackrock Clinic, surrounded in her last days by her beloved husband Hugh, sons Edward and Julian, daughter-in-law Pam, granddaughter Emily, sisters Nuala and Patsy and friends, and in the loving care of the staff of the Blackrock Clinic. Rest in peace. Respected poet, playwright, broadcaster with R.T.E. and author; deeply missed by her beloved family and friends. Removal this (Monday) evening from the Blackrock Clinic to St. John the Baptist Church, Blackrock arriving at 5 o'clock Funeral tomorrow (Tuesday) after 10 o'clock Mass to Shanganagh Cemetery. Family flowers only. Donations if desired to Blackrock Hospice. House Private."My pain was gone/Borne away on the melody/of that enduring song"
